I don&#x27;t think you can pluck someone out of their historical context like this,<p>Could Newton get published today? I doubt it.<p>Could Picasso of the 1930s be as influential today? Probably not; the art world has changed.<p>Would Babe Ruth be a famous baseball player today? Stephen J. Gould makes the argument that (quoting <a href="https:&#x2F;&#x2F;en.wikipedia.org&#x2F;wiki&#x2F;Stephen_Jay_Gould#Cultural_evolution" rel="nofollow">https:&#x2F;&#x2F;en.wikipedia.org&#x2F;wiki&#x2F;Stephen_Jay_Gould#Cultural_evo...</a> ):<p>&gt; ... the disappearance of the 0.400 batting average in baseball is paradoxically due to the inclusion of better players in the league, rather than players becoming worse over time.<p>We have many &quot;better players&quot; in physics now than we did during Einstein&#x27;s time.
